Changing the wick in a kerosene heater is an important upkeep process that ensures optimum efficiency, security, and longevity of the equipment. A wick is a material or fiberglass twine that attracts kerosene from the gasoline tank to the combustion chamber, the place it’s burned to generate warmth. Over time, wicks can grow to be clogged with soot and particles, decreasing their means to soak up gasoline and resulting in inefficient combustion and potential security hazards.
Common wick alternative is important for sustaining the heater’s effectivity and stopping untimely failure. A brand new wick permits for correct gasoline movement, guaranteeing full combustion and most warmth output. It additionally helps forestall the buildup of soot and carbon deposits inside the heater, which might result in overheating, lowered lifespan, and potential hearth dangers.
Changing a kerosene heater wick is a comparatively easy process that may be accomplished in just a few steps. First, make sure the heater is cool and disconnected from the ability supply. Take away the gasoline tank and punctiliously elevate out the previous wick. Clear the wick holder and insert the brand new wick, guaranteeing it’s correctly seated and centered. Reassemble the heater, refill the gasoline tank, and permit the wick to soak up gasoline for 15-20 minutes earlier than lighting the heater.

Ceaselessly Requested Questions on Changing a Wick in a Kerosene Heater
Changing a wick in a kerosene heater is an important upkeep process that ensures optimum efficiency, security, and longevity. Listed below are solutions to some widespread questions and issues associated to this course of:
Query 1: How typically ought to I substitute the wick in my kerosene heater?
The frequency of wick alternative is dependent upon utilization and upkeep practices. Usually, it is strongly recommended to interchange the wick yearly or extra often if the heater is closely used or the wick exhibits indicators of wear and tear or deterioration.
Query 2: What sort of wick ought to I exploit for my kerosene heater?
Totally different kerosene heater fashions might require particular wick varieties. It’s important to seek the advice of the heater’s handbook or producer’s tips to find out the right wick measurement and materials in your heater.
Query 3: How can I guarantee correct wick set up?
Correct wick set up includes seating the wick accurately within the wick holder and guaranteeing it’s centered and stage. This enables for optimum gasoline movement and steady combustion. Check with the heater’s handbook for particular directions on wick set up.
Query 4: Can I exploit a unique gasoline in my kerosene heater?
Kerosene heaters are designed to make use of kerosene gasoline solely. Utilizing different fuels can harm the heater, create security hazards, and void the guarantee.
Query 5: How do I troubleshoot a kerosene heater that’s not heating correctly?
In case your kerosene heater will not be heating effectively, examine for a clogged wick, incorrect wick set up, or inadequate gasoline. Make sure the heater is correctly ventilated and freed from any obstructions that will impede airflow.
Query 6: Is it protected to go away a kerosene heater unattended?
Kerosene heaters ought to by no means be left unattended whereas in operation. At all times supervise the heater and guarantee it’s positioned on a steady, non-flammable floor away from flamable supplies.
